Reservations are available at this 55-plus RV park in New Port Richey, Florida, which provides full hookups (electric, water, and sewer) for rigs up to 65 feet. The park includes a pool, laundry facilities, and WiFi, though outdoor patio space is limited and picnic tables are small. No pets are allowed. Construction noise from across the street has been a factor, and requesting a site toward the back of the park reduces the impact. Ants are common, so bug spray is worth packing.
